Understanding the Demotion Email Template

A Demotion Email Template serves as a structured framework for delivering difficult news to an employee. It's not just about conveying information; it's about doing so in a way that respects the individual and minimizes potential negative impact. The importance of a clear and compassionate demotion email template cannot be overstated, as it sets the tone for future interactions and impacts employee morale.

  • Clarity: Ensures all necessary information is included.
  • Consistency: Maintains fairness across similar situations.
  • Professionalism: Upholds company standards.

When constructing such an email, consider the following elements:

  1. Direct and unambiguous statement of the change.
  2. Explanation of the reasons behind the decision.
  3. Outline of the new role and responsibilities.
  4. Information regarding compensation and benefits adjustments.
  5. Support resources available to the employee.
  6. Next steps and timeline.

Here's a simple table outlining key components:

Component Purpose
Subject Line Clear and concise indication of the email's content.
Opening Directly state the purpose of the email.
Reasoning Provide a brief, factual explanation.
New Role Details Describe the adjusted responsibilities and title.
Logistical Changes Outline impact on pay, benefits, etc.
Support Offer assistance and resources.
Closing Professional and forward-looking.

Demotion Email Template for Performance Issues

Subject: Update Regarding Your Role at [Company Name]

Dear [Employee Name],

This email is to inform you of a change in your role at [Company Name], effective [Date]. Following a review of your performance against established expectations, it has been determined that your current role as [Previous Role Title] is no longer the best fit. We have observed consistent challenges in [mention specific areas without being overly accusatory, e.g., meeting project deadlines, achieving key performance indicators].

As a result, your role will be transitioned to [New Role Title] within the [Department Name] department. In this new capacity, your primary responsibilities will include [list 2-3 key new responsibilities]. We believe this adjustment will allow you to leverage your strengths more effectively and contribute to the team in a way that aligns better with our current needs.

Your compensation will be adjusted to [New Salary] per annum, effective [Date]. All other benefits remain unchanged. We are committed to supporting you through this transition. [Manager Name] will be available to discuss this further with you on [Date] at [Time] in [Location/Virtual Meeting Link]. Please feel free to prepare any questions you may have.

Sincerely,

[Your Name/HR Department]

Demotion Email Template for Role Reorganization

Subject: Important Update: Role Adjustment and Transition

Dear [Employee Name],

This message is to inform you about an upcoming change to your role as part of a broader organizational restructuring aimed at improving efficiency and aligning our resources with strategic priorities. Effective [Date], your current position as [Previous Role Title] will be impacted.

As part of this reorganization, you will be transitioning to a new role as [New Role Title]. This new position will focus on [briefly describe the focus, e.g., supporting key operational initiatives, contributing to a new project team]. We believe your experience in [mention a relevant skill or experience] will be a valuable asset in this capacity.

There will be no immediate change to your compensation or benefits. We are committed to ensuring a smooth transition and will provide all necessary support. [Manager Name] will be scheduling a meeting with you shortly to discuss the details of your new role and answer any questions you may have.

Thank you for your understanding and continued dedication.

Sincerely,

[Your Name/HR Department]
